What is a Tube Cutter?

A tube cutter is a specialized tool designed to cut thin-walled metal pipes, including copper pipes. It typically consists of a circular cutting head, an adjustable handle, and a cutting wheel. The cutting wheel is made of hardened steel and is responsible for scoring and separating the pipe.

How to Use a Tube Cutter to Cut Copper Pipe: A Step-by-Step Guide

  1. Gather Your Materials: You will need a tube cutter, copper pipe, and a permanent marker.
  2. Mark the Cutting Line: Measure and mark the desired cutting point on the copper pipe using a permanent marker.
  3. Position the Tube Cutter: Place the tube cutter over the pipe, with the cutting wheel aligned with the marked line.
  4. Tighten the Handle: Tighten the handle of the tube cutter to secure the pipe in place.
  5. Rotate the Cutter: Rotate the tube cutter around the pipe while applying firm pressure.
  6. Release and Inspect: Once the pipe is cut, release the handle and inspect the cut. If necessary, gently remove any burrs or rough edges using fine-grit sandpaper.

Types of Tube Cutters for Copper Pipe

  • Ratcheting Tube Cutter: Ideal for repetitive cuts, offering a smooth and controlled operation.
  • Mini Tube Cutter: Compact and lightweight, designed for small-diameter pipes.
  • Heavy-Duty Tube Cutter: Built to handle thicker pipes, providing extra durability and cutting power.
  • Hydraulic Tube Cutter: Uses hydraulic pressure to make clean and precise cuts on large-diameter pipes.

Choosing the Right Tube Cutter

Selecting the right tube cutter for copper pipe depends on several factors:

  • Pipe Diameter: Tube cutters have different cutting capacities, so choose one that can accommodate the diameter of the copper pipe you will be cutting.
  • Usage: Consider the frequency and type of cutting you will be doing. If you need to make a lot of cuts, a ratcheting tube cutter may be a better option.
  • Ergonomics: Choose a tube cutter that is comfortable to hold and use, especially if you will be working for long periods.
  • Budget: Tube cutters vary in price, so consider your budget and the value for money you are getting.

Troubleshooting Tube Cutter Problems

  • Burring or Distortion: Use a deburring tool or fine-grit sandpaper to smooth out any rough edges.
  • Leaking Connection: Check that the cut is clean and perpendicular to the pipe. Tighten the connection and use a sealant if necessary.
  • Difficulty Cutting: Ensure the cutting wheel is sharp and the pipe is not bent or damaged. Lubricate the cutting wheel with oil or WD-40 if needed.
  • Damage to Cutting Wheel: Replace the cutting wheel if it shows signs of damage, such as chips or cracks.
